About ClipTurn
ClipTurn is a small Windows 11 app that rotates a video the way you rotate a photo: right-click the file in File Explorer, choose rotate left or right, and it is done. No export dialog, no codec questions, no new filename to manage. It physically turns the picture stored in the video instead of only setting an orientation flag that some players ignore, so the new orientation travels with the file to any player, editor, website or device. Before the source is replaced, ClipTurn builds a candidate and verifies it locally (file identity, picture geometry, stream preservation). If it cannot prove a faithful result, it refuses, explains why, and leaves your original untouched. What you get: - Rotate left and rotate right commands built into the File Explorer right-click menu. - Automatic decisions: no codec lists, bitrate guesses, quality sliders or output-format questions. - Preserves audio, subtitles, metadata, extra soundtracks, colour information and HDR where supported. - Batch Rotate a whole folder, with an individual result and a clear explanation for every file. - Verification receipts and a System Capabilities view that stay on your device. - Seven supported file types: MP4, M4V, MOV, MKV, WebM, WMV and uncompressed AVI. - 100% local processing: no account, no sign-in, no uploads. - Currently free on the Microsoft Store, with no trial timer, feature gate or subscription. Honest limits are part of the design: compressed video is re-encoded (only uncompressed packed-pixel AVI can be rotated sample-exactly), a successful Explorer rotation replaces the file with no undo, and some codecs depend on what your PC has installed.
